Hi Everyone,

I'm on Windows 7, 64 bit. I've been using previous versions of x-lite for years and never noticed this problem. The initial footprint for 5.0 when I load it is around 120,000 (seems much larger than before although I don't have a record) and then grows over time so that within a day its over 300,000. Anyone else see this problem. If anyone from Counterpath is reading this, can you tell me it this is a replicable problem and if you plan to address it?
